polyphonic
/,pɑli'fɑnɪk/
adjective
10 letters4 syllables22 points in Scrabble®25 points in WWF®
DEFINITIONS3
ADJECTIVE
1
Of or relating to or characterized by polyphony.
“polyphonic traditions of the baroque”
2
Having two or more independent but harmonically related melodic parts sounding together.
3
Having two or more phonetic values.
“polyphonic letters such as `a'”
